Phil Wortley MRICS
Regional Director
and Chartered Surveyor
Having studied at Leicester University at the end of the 1990s, Phil worked for Vodafone as a project manager. In 2007 he qualified as a Home Inspector ready to complete reports under the government’s requirements for Home Information Packs. After completing a conversion course and qualifying as a technical surveyor and associate member of the RICS in 2008, Phil completed a Post Graduate Diploma in Surveying at the University of Reading and gained Chartered status in May 2015. He lives with his wife and two children in South Oxfordshire.
